Modern Curriculum Press Mathematics (MCP)

MCP is an economical basic math program with textbooks for grades K through 6. MCP Math includes consumable workbooks that are in red, black, and white with simple drawings as illustration. It also comes with a teacher’s guide that is simple to follow, featuring a section that helps students correct common errors. Each lesson covers the math concept and the methods for finding the solutions methods in a traditional way. Many word problems are included. There are separate sections for problem solving.

Modern Curriculum Press Mathematics uses a traditional drill and practice format. MCP Math can be used as a supplemental text, though as a primary text it is more popular with homeschooling families than government schools. Each book is smaller than a typical traditional hardback textbook, or compared to some newer text series which may include many textbooks, or no textbook at all to bring home.

The low cost of this curriculum and its simplicity makes it an attractive choice to many homeschool parents. The texts were not designed to conform to the controversial NCTM standards of mathematics reform, which is also appealing to many homeschool families.

MCP Math Curriculum is  a less expensive alternative to the popular Saxon math textbooks. In contrast to Saxon’s method of combining many skills, Modern Curriculum Press usually presents one skill at a time. There have been a few complaints that some of the units have too many practice problems, but this is easily overcome by just to requiring that every problem is solved. Extra practice may be needed from time to time, and when such is the case, extra problems are appreciated.

MCP (Grades K-6) Mathematics Levels K, A-F includes

  • Models for each lesson to help students learn concepts and skills
  • Problem Solving lessons to introduce strategies for solving real-life problems
  • Abundant opportunities for practice to ensure mastery of skills
  • Chapter tests to help students prepare for standardized tests
  • Field Trips (Levels A, B) and Excursions (Levels C-F) to help students practice critical thinking skills
  • Easy-to-follow lesson plans
